A Beneficiary Company account allows businesses to seamlessly receive payouts, commissions, incentives, or partner funds from one or more paying organizations (remitters). Through Xtrm's connected architecture, beneficiary companies can view incoming funds, manage multi-currency balances, and handle secondary distribution to their own employees or contractors.
Key Concepts & Connection Types
1. Remitter (Payer) Connections
When a company pays you via Xtrm, a connection is automatically established between your account and theirs.
Visibility: You can view connected remitters in your Xtrm account under Connected Accounts.
Multi-Payer Support: A single beneficiary company account can receive payments from multiple different remitters simultaneously without creating separate accounts.
2. Connected vs. Independent Accounts
Connected Beneficiary: A sub-account or partner account created directly by a remitter on your behalf.
Independent Account: An account registered directly by your business at www.xtrm.com which can then connect to multiple remitters.
Employer payments are payments sent to your company account instead of directly to your employees who may have been responsible or entitled to the payment. Beneficiary company Users can log into Xtrm to review the amount received and the transaction breakdown.
If you have received an Employer payment to your company account and you would like to transfer these funds to individuals, then please follow these instructions.
Your Employer payment will include a breakdown of the individuals that contributed towards that payment. You can view those details, and then if you want, you can process the transaction to those individuals. They will receive payments in their Xtrm Individual wallet, and your company account will be debited.

How to Process Payments to Employees

Review the list of individuals who contributed to the payment on the detail screen. Click the Process button and follow the prompts in the Payment to disburse the funds to those individuals.

Follow the wizard prompts through to completion:
Adjust Recipients & Amounts: You can keep the default distribution or edit the individual recipients and amounts (e.g., reducing amounts to cover internal fees).
Delivery & Notification: Payments are delivered directly to each individual’s Xtrm AnyPay wallet, and an automated email notification is released to them upon completion.
Flexibility Option: You are not required to disburse funds to individuals—you can also choose to distribute funds to partners or transfer the entire amount directly to your business bank account.
